Edgestream Partners L.P. purchased a new position in shares of DTE Energy Company (NYSE:DTE - Free Report) in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or purchased 18,931 shares of the utilities provider's stock, valued at approximately $2,508,000.

DTE Energy Trading Down 0.8%

Shares of DTE stock opened at $132.16 on Friday. DTE Energy Company has a 12-month low of $116.30 and a 12-month high of $143.79. The company has a market capitalization of $27.45 billion, a PE ratio of 19.84,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.61 and a beta of 0.47. The firm has a 50 day moving average price of $138.40 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$136.80. The company has a quick ratio of 0.68, a current ratio of 1.15 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.01.

DTE Energy (NYSE:DTE -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, October 30th. The utilities provider reported $2.25 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$2.10 by $0.15. The company had revenue of $3.53 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.23 billion. DTE Energy had a return on equity of 12.63% and a net margin of 9.34%.During the same quarter last year, the company earned $2.22 earnings per share. DTE Energy has set its FY 2025 guidance at 7.090-7.230 EPS and its FY 2026 guidance at 7.590-7.730 EPS. As a group, analysts predict that DTE Energy Company will post 7.18 earnings per share for the current year.

DTE Energy Increases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, January 15th. Stockholders of record on Monday, December 15th will be given a $1.165 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, December 15th. This is a boost from DTE Energy's previous quarterly dividend of $1.09. This represents a $4.66 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.5%. DTE Energy's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 65.47%.

DTE Energy Company Profile

(Free Report)

DTE Energy Company engages in the utility operations. The company's Electric segment generates, purchases, distributes, and sells electricity to various residential, commercial, and industrial customers in southeastern Michigan. It generates electricity through coal-fired plants, hydroelectric pumped storage, and nuclear plants, as well as wind and solar assets.
